The event season is slowing down, but that doesn’t mean area chambers of commerce are taking a break. They’ll be taking a look at how lawmakers in Jefferson City could impact the businesses the chamber represents. K.C. Cloke is the Executive Director of the Lake Area Chamber of Commerce. She says lobbying isn’t a huge part of what they do, but they will keep an eye on the legislature.
Cloke says that while the chamber does have a lobbying role, they mostly act as intermediaries for their businesses and respond to their needs and interests.
